GTN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

159 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gray Television (GTN)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$712M — down 17% from $863M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 28 funds opened new GTN positions and 24 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 65 added to existing stakes and 54 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, adding an estimated $17.9M. The largest seller was Glenhill Advisors, cutting an estimated $34.2M.
